Description
Free Augmented Reality App to help designers and color deficient people with six color blindness modes.
Design:
Designers can simulate Color Deficiencies to see what a color deficient person would see when looking at interior designs, website designs, or game designs.
When used in design systems the user will be able to see exactly what their designs are preventing colorblind users from seeing. When they see that indistinctness they will easily be able to change the color scheme of their website or game to one that is distinguishable between users
Games can be the hardest to determine what a colorblind user cannot see because of action. Enliven is in real time
Color Blind
Use textures to easily see colors that are difficult to differentiate. By selecting a color that is easily visible to the colorblind user, the augmented reality application uses a special algorithm to show the colorblind user what they are missing. This will then let them make better decisions when using systems that are different color
